AGARTALA, Sep 25 (TIWN): Tripura Ex-CM Manik Sarkar's wife, social worker Panchali Bhattacharjee has slammed the ruling BJP for forcing Anganwadi, Asha Employees to walk in rallies hanging Modi's photos on bodies.
She also said, if anybody denies to go in rallies regardless girls and women with slang language the BJP activists abuse them.
"It's really shameful that Anganwadi, Mid-day-meal employees are being forced to walk with Modi's photos when only Rs. 2000 rupees have been hiked for them but it was in demand that the wages must be given at Rs. 18,000", she added.
Panchali Bhattacharjee further said that she is also proud of public response during "Hartal" on Sep 10, when a successful strike was observed without any propaganda by Left Parties, saying, "Public displayed their anger on the BJP govt on Sep 10".
The press conference was held by CITU demanding wages of Anganwadi / Asha employees at least Rs. 18000 per month observing the price hikes countrywide.
